Output 31359071ada225ffdff2bdc3160643f8e76efd6f2010bcab23b622650826012c:0

value
672861365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e555eca7fa7adf5e89533f5b8e481a9d14f6ce55 OP_EQUAL
address
3NbdbcC39hoFjQBRUy7Sv4KbwevQ57WtYX
transaction
31359071ada225ffdff2bdc3160643f8e76efd6f2010bcab23b622650826012c
spent
true